IBM Delivers New System z Software Capabilities

IBM announced new System z software to enable companies to drive down IT costs while increasing business flexibility and improving service. The company plans to release approximately 30 new software technology enhancements in 2009 that extend the advantages of using System z as a platform for developing, deploying and running applications and business data.

The announcement is part of IBM’s ongoing pursuit to help customers simplify their environment and reduce costs by migrating scattered applications and data onto a lower cost, more scalable and manageable platform.

The software initiative spans IBM’s branded product lines for application architecture, development, and delivery; business intelligence and database management; transaction management and IT service management.

Market adoption of System z as a platform for new applications is demonstrated by the growth in ISV interest in the IBM mainframe. Over the last year, more than 150 new ISVs have embraced the platform, and more than 1,000 new vendor applications were added.

IBM today announced 12 of the 30 software products and enhancements for System z.

For application architecture, development, and delivery: IBM Rational System Architect v11.3 and Rational Focal Point for Product and Portfolio Management v6.4; IBM Rational Developer for System z v7.6; and IBM Rational Team Concert for System z v2.0.

For business intelligence and new database technology, recently announced and future IBM software products include: InfoSphere Warehouse for System z; Cognos 8 BI for Linux on System z v8.4. The next Version of DB2 for z/OS will boost performance, lower administration and maintenance requirements, while improving the efficiency of application developers and database administrators. Available later this year, IMS 11 provides Open Database support which makes interaction with other applications and databases much simpler, faster, and more cost effective to implement.

For transaction management, recently announced IBM software products include: CICS Transaction Server v4.1 and WebSphere Business Events v6.2.1 for z/OS.

For IT Service Management, Tivoli OMEGAMON provides integrated monitoring throughout the enterprise to assure the highest quality application performance. Tivoli Security Management for z/OS helps simplify security administration and user management, establish security policy controls, and automate auditing and compliance reporting. Tivoli Key Lifecycle Management for z/OS delivers platform independent, extreme security for corporate information which can be accessed by thousands of applications inside and outside the enterprise, while combining automated management to minimize required maintenance. Tivoli Workload Scheduler v8.5 provides more intelligent scheduling, boosting throughput with minimal human intervention through increased automation.
